Forty first death anniversary of renowned Pakistani actor Allauddin Ahmad was observed on Monday. He was born in 1923 in Rawalpindi. His film career spanned over four decades. Allauddin was one of the very few Pakistani film actors who mostly acted as a villain, comedian and sometimes as a lead actor in his films. He recieved Nigar Awards seven times for Best Supporting Actor and Special Nigar Award for film Badnaam. Source: Radio Pakistan
